Covid-19 insurance to be extended to all of Andalucia from 1 January 2021

The Vice President and Minister of Tourism, Juan Marín, announced on Thursday 1 October in Malaga that the Junta will take out insurance to cover the expenses of international tourists who come to the region as of January 1 in the event that get the coronavirus while in Andalucia. Marín said that there will be 9 million euros for the Andalucian tourist voucher.

Marín has ensured that

international travelers will have “guaranteed” expenses that may arise from their stay in a hospital, their confinement or return to their place of origin.

The counselor has indicated that a public tender will be opened so that insurance agencies can present their offers and has stressed that this measure will take effect from January 1 because it has been claimed by tourism companies and airlines.

The president of the Association of Hotel Entrepreneurs of the Costa del Sol (Aehcos), Luis Callejón, noted that “Malaga hotels have been providing similar insurance free of charge to our clients since May, an insurance which includes assistance 24-hour telematics, transfer to hospitals and even repatriation to their countries.”
